"jc" == Jacques Caron <caronj@psi.com> writes: So, if I understand correctly, nobody on this list uses the "Please update filters" messages, and only set maximum prefixes on the BGP sessions?
Sorry for the late response.
We use the "Please update filters" messages from our peers as follows: Upon receipt of such a message, we regenerate the filters from IRR information. Then we either confirm that we now accept the routes mentioned in the message, or we ask the peer to put them in the IRR.
Do you regenerate all your filters, or just the ones for that peer? And do you regenerate them otherwise? I.e. do you NEED the messages, or is it just an additional layer of sanity checking?
